Former Rhode Island House Finance Chair Raymond Gallison had close to $1 million seized by the Federal Bureau of Investigation, days following his resignation from the General Assembly in May.

A legal notice posted by the FBI on Thursday shows that Gallison had  $781,774.29 taken from six accounts under his control in Rhode Island on May 6; over $211,000 was seized from two accounts in Northern California. 

A spokeswoman for the FBI office declined comment on Thursday.

Following Gallison's resignation in May, Rep. Marvin Abney was named as the new finance chair; Speaker of the House Nicholas Mattiello then confirmed Gallison is under investigation by federal authorities.
